  ### 4. Overall poor experience

**Rating:** 0.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Lauren P. | Program Director,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** November 15, 2022

**What do you like best about Phreesia?**

Self scheduling more customizable than our EMR options
More customization with patient communications
Integration of forms with our EMR

**What do you dislike about Phreesia?**

Misleading verbiage and vague wording in contract
Amount of labor required on our end to ensure forms set up correctly
They upsell you on everything
Advertisements during patient check in - they have a clause in their check in consent that allows patient medical information to be used for targeted advertisement
Overall shady practices

**What problems is Phreesia solving and how is that benefiting you?**

1. Configuration is good, but not perfect. Be prepared to review everything that is built for your practice with a VERY fine toothed comb as more often than I would prefer, forms that I requested to be built were either built incorrectly, or matched with the wrong appointments, or did not input into the Athena chart like requested, or there were duplicates. It became a very frustrating and laborous process to ensure our forms were correct.

2. They will try to upsell you on everything, and I recommend you read the fine print before you commit to a new add-on. While some of the features were really useful for us, like self scheduling (which allowed us much more customization for our practice compared to Athena), we are now locked into using the product because of a clause in our contract. We only used self scheduling for covid testing blitzes and now we don't use it. But we have to keep paying. Okay, fine, I understand it is in the contract. Just pay very close attention to what you sign.

3. Make sure to read your contract VERY carefully and make note of your effective date on your order form. Your contract will automatically renew after 12 months or what they call your "initial term". But keep in mind, your contract will have 2 phases - Phase 1 which is an evaluation phase where you can decide if you like the product, and Phase 2 is your committed term where you pay monthly fees. BUT DON'T GET BLINDSIDED - your 12 month intial term is both Phase 1 and Phase 2. Don't make the mistake I did where I assumed our 12 month term was 12 months of paid usage that began in Phase 2. We are now locked into a contract with a product we do not want to use for another year.

4. No one from the team will inform you of your contract renewing. Yes I understand in the contract is states it will automatically renew, but this is poor customer service in my opinion.

5. Your monthly fee is based off of the number of providers in your practice. However, be aware - in Athena, anyone you put in as a "provider" needing their own schedule is considered a "provider" by Phreesia. I put these in quotations becasue let's say you wanted to have an MA have their own schedule because they do things like blood draws, and you don't want to muddy up your actual Provider's schedule. Or maybe you build more providers in Athena because you want to be able to have multiple people sign encounters instead of only allowing one scribe to sign and an actual provider sign (for example, I am an RN and the only way I could co-sign an encounter is if I am built in Athena as a "provider". Perhaps this is more of an Athena issue, but it still impacts Phreesia workflows). Anyways - when you make an MA or an RN as a provider in Athena, Phreesia will try to charge you for that. At one point, they wanted to charge us for 11 providers, when we only have 2 actual providers - an MD and an NP.  It doesn't make financial sense from a practice standpoint to pay $60 per provider per month when you are only actually billing for the work of 2 providers. So take a close look at the structure of your practice and determine if this is the right choice for you. Fortunately, Phreesia has been willing to work with me and they haven't charged me for 11 providers, but it has required a lot of explanation to the Phreesia team and also requires us to figure out work arounds in Athena to make things work for us. It is incredibly complicated.

6. Daylight savings time. Oh boy. Our practice is located in Arizona, and we do not change because of Daylight Savings Time. However, last winter our communications to patients from Phreesia regarding any appointment times scheduled were showing as an hour ahead of actually scheduled. We had patients showing up before we even opened our doors. And this happened even though we were configured in Athena as Arizona time. I had to make a case and work with their internal team to resolve this, and it took some time to fix. They may have resolved this issue for other practices, but keep a note if this might pertain to you.

7. Touch base calls - these are not fun. You will be assigned a customer service representative that will go over analytics with you, however I felt more often than not that I had to continually explain why our self check in rates were low. Much of our practice clientelle are Medicare patients. They are elderly. They don't know how to use a cell phone or computer to check into their appointments. Our team helps them with this. It gets exhausting to constantly have to justify your low check in rates with someone from Phreesia.

8. Overall - Phreesia does have functionality that helps where Athena falls short. And it may be great for your practice! However, Athena is working on addressing these shortfalls in their Fall release, and I believe their Spring release in 2023. We look forward to these releases so that we can have our workflows in one platform, and no longer use Phreesia. This software might work for you, but I encourage you to keep note of the above when you consider signing.

  ### 6. Use Difficult for Seniors

**Rating:** 0.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Verified User in Hospital & Health Care |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** February 19, 2019

**What do you like best about Phreesia?**

I can use the device easily. I am 38 yrs.

**What do you dislike about Phreesia?**

My dad (82) cant use the device. He is not technically inclined. Even if he was his fingers are too big to use this device. During our visit to this medical office he was asked to get up three separate times to complete the procedure of using this device. My dad has a difficult time standing up from a chair and gets winded walking short distances. Three times he had to get up and down and walk back and forth just to review if the information they already had on file was correct. This device played no role in improving the effiency in this office and compromised the health and comfort of my elderly dad. 

**What problems is Phreesia solving and how is that benefiting you?**

I see opportunities that need to be addressed. It takes just as long (if not twice as long) for the receptionist to explain to the patient what the tablet is, how to use, and why it is necessary than it would take the receptionist to just verify the information herself. This device slows progress in this facility. Half the patients do not have the ability to use this device. I suggest more research to be conducted on who will be using this device and what it will be used for. Does this device improve the efficiency of this type of business and is the purchase of this device worth the job or function it is replacing.

  ### 7. Did not function as expected. Paid for a year and never used.

**Rating:** 0.5/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Verified User in Medical Practice |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** January 24, 2018

**What do you like best about Phreesia?**

Customer service was helpful to tell me all of the things Phreesia couldn't do. Communication was quick till we decided we weren't going to use the system. Software may be helpful in a slow practice setting needing minimal patient feedback/information. If you need to just check in and collect a copay, this may be an OK system for your practice. 

**What do you dislike about Phreesia?**

Software could not implement office documents as expected. The check in process was slower using this service during our testing than a manual check in with a short follow up questionare. We signed up for this service to speed up the check in process and continue to move to a paperless process. The software could not implement PDF or manipulate any documents on the hardware ( E.G.  add text, check a box, provide patient consent, signature,  ETC.). We never went live with the product. We paid for a year of service and never used it. Phreesia would not release us from contract even after we made the case that the system did not function anywhere close to our needs. We also found the hardware heavy and cumbersome. If you have any elderly patients , this may not be the best choice for them.

**Recommendations to others considering Phreesia:**

System is good for minimal work (check in and copay), nothing extensive. Make sure this is enough before signing with them. 

**What problems is Phreesia solving and how is that benefiting you?**

Phreesia provided good customer service on start up and while trouble shooting implementation. This did drop off however once we realized we couldn't truly implement the product as desired.
